A huge Mexican restaurant with great vibes! We came for lunch in a Friday around 1, and we were sat immediately in a pretty big booth. There were tons of seating: floor, booth, outside,bar. The menu is pretty big also with a lot of variety. I got the large Queso to start. It was yellow queso, which isn't my favorite, but it fed four of us. As an entree, I got the chicken con queso. This came with an avocado, rice, beans, and two tortillas, and I got the queso on the side. The grilled chicken was delicious. My friends got the enchiladas and bang bang shrimp tacos, which both looked pretty good. There is also an ice cream machine, where you can get free ice cream throughout your time! Our waitress was ok... the food took a good minute to come out. But, she was fine. I would come back again!

Jeff N.

Been to other locations. And always have good service and food is consistent. Plenty of parking and plenty of tables inside and out. I went ahead and used the waitlist on their website that works thru OpenTable. I got on waitlist 30 mins before my arrival time. I was #38 but once I arrived at 7:10 and checked in I was #9 and my total wait time was maybe 10 mins. I highly recommend everyone do the waitlist to be in line before you get there.. I ordered the pollo marisco which is chicken breast, shrimp and crawfish tails and rice, cucumber salad and beans.. my date ordered a similar chicken dish named Tampico Really good food, portions are good and prices reasonable...total was $48 before tip..but we didn't get any adult beverages just sweet tea and strawberry lemonade.
